A Study of Impact of Art on Successful Aging
Yong Ran Cho,Jeong Sik Cha,Hey Ryoen Kang 한국노인복지학회 2012 International Journal of Welfare for the Aged Vol.27 No.-
This study aimed to reveal impact of art and daily activities on the emotionality of the adults aged 60 or more. Results on the effects of physical activities on satisfaction show that art performance physical activities improve emotional wellbeing of old people, and therefore the subjects who perform those activities longer than two hours a week have highest level of satisfaction with wellbeing and medical services. Regarding social security benefit, certainly there is a linkage between the benefit and satisfaction; those without the benefit even has higher satisfaction with welfare satisfaction, indicating that lower socioeconomic status has negative impacts on satisfaction even though they receive welfare benefits.
